About this podcast

Discover the enchanting myths and legends of the Pacific Northwest, particularly from Washington and Oregon. This collection focuses on authentic tales, carefully selected to exclude influences from both Western religions and the coarseness of indigenous narratives. Immerse yourself in creation myths, stories of the origins of races, the theft of fire, and the significance of salmon, all intertwined with the regions breathtaking landscapes, including Takhoma, Shasta, and the Columbia River. While this volume does not claim originality in the myths themselves, it aims to present them in a manner that preserves the simplicity and authenticity of the original storytelling. Join us on a journey through these timeless narratives, told as the Native Americans intended.
